This print captures the essence of Mistinguett, a renowned French music hall actress, singer, and film star from the early 20th century. The image showcases Mistinguett alongside her knightly companion in a colorful caricature from Le Rire magazine in 1918. Created by Italian artist Italo Orsi, this lithograph beautifully portrays the medieval-inspired costumes worn by both figures. Mistinguett's glamorous attire reflects her status as an entertainer extraordinaire, while her knight exudes chivalry and strength. Their contrasting roles symbolize the dynamic nature of their performances on stage - she as a talented female artist and he as her loyal protector. The composition also highlights elements of traditional armor with intricate mesh detailing and plate armor adorning the knight's body. This visual juxtaposition between Mistinguett's feminine costume and the male figure's armored clothing adds depth to their characters' portrayal. As we delve into this historical snapshot, it becomes evident that Maurice Chevalier (1888-1972) played an integral role in Mistinguett's life. Jeanne Bourgeois, known professionally as Mistinguett, found immense success during her career with Chevalier often accompanying her on stage or screen.
